
In today’s digital world, cybersecurity, information security, and privacy protection are critical for organizations handling sensitive data. ISO/IEC 27001:2022 is the international standard for Information Security Management Systems (ISMS), providing a structured framework to protect data, mitigate risks, and ensure compliance with global cybersecurity regulations.
